Adarsh's Guide to Cybersecurity, AI and CAREER Advancement

Stay up-to-date about Artificial Intelligence, Cybersecurity and stay ahead in your Career!


Unveiling the Advantages of Distributed Systems

Imagine a bustling city – cars navigate complex intersections, buildings rise high, and information flows through a network of wires and cables. Just like a city functions more efficiently by distributing tasks across its various components, distributed systems revolutionize how we handle data and applications in the digital age.

What are Distributed Systems?

Unlike traditional single-server systems, distributed systems are composed of multiple independent computers (nodes) working together as a cohesive unit. Each node plays a specific role, sharing data and collaborating to achieve a common goal. Think of it as an orchestra – each instrument has its own part, but together they create a harmonious symphony.

Why Go Distributed? 5 Advantages That Make a Difference

Distributed systems offer a multitude of advantages over their single-server counterparts. Here are five key benefits:

  1. High Scalability

Imagine a restaurant overwhelmed by a sudden rush. A single server might struggle, but a distributed system scales seamlessly. By adding more nodes, you can distribute the workload, ensuring smooth operation even during peak traffic. This makes distributed systems ideal for applications with fluctuating or ever-growing user bases.

  1. Ensuring High Availability

Cities are built with redundancy – alternate routes and backup systems ensure continued operation. Similarly, distributed systems are designed for high availability. If one node fails, the others pick up the slack, ensuring minimal downtime and uninterrupted service for users. This resilience is crucial for applications that require continuous operation, like online banking or e-commerce platforms.

  1. Enhanced Performance

Distributing tasks across multiple nodes unlocks the power of parallel processing. Imagine multiple chefs working simultaneously in a kitchen – a distributed system operates in a similar fashion. This division of labor leads to faster processing times and improved responsiveness, allowing applications to handle complex tasks efficiently.

  1. Flexibility

Cities constantly evolve, adapting to new needs. Distributed systems offer similar flexibility. Developers can easily add new features or functionalities by incorporating additional nodes or services into the network. This adaptability allows them to respond to changing user demands and technological advancements without major infrastructure overhauls.

  1. Geographic Distribution

Imagine a concert broadcasted live across different time zones. Distributed systems can achieve similar geographic reach. By deploying nodes across various locations, applications can provide low-latency access to users worldwide. This is beneficial for geographically dispersed user bases and ensures redundancy in case of regional outages.

Conclusion:

Distributed systems are the cornerstone of today’s digital landscape, powering everything from social media platforms to complex scientific simulations. As technology continues to evolve, distributed systems will undoubtedly play an even greater role in shaping our connected world. So, the next time you experience the seamless operation of a large-scale online service, remember – it’s the power of many working together, a testament to the remarkable capabilities of distributed systems.



Leave a comment

About Me

Engineering Leader with over 20+ years of experience at Cisco, NetApp/ Cybersecurity/ Artificial Intelligence/ Mentor/ Cybersecurity and AI Consultant

I share my unique insights and learnings on the latest trends and topics in technology, mostly around Artificial Intelligence and Cybersecurity and Ransomware, based on my vast professional experience. This is your go-to source for upskilling.

For coaching related queries, please reach: adarshacademy.ai@gmail.com

Subscribe: https://www.youtube.com/@TechTalksFromAdarsh

Please subscribe to the newsletter to stay up-to-date!

Please follow me in YouTube & Twitter:

PLEASE SUBSCRIBE TO Newsletter: